JAAC strike: Markets, streets deserted in AJK's Muzaffarabad but no demonstrations held

A strike by the newly proscribed Joint Awami Action Committee (JAAC) left Muzaffarabad, the capital of Azad Jammu and Kashmir (AJK), largely deserted, with shops and traffic closed. AJK Prime Minister Faisal Mumtaz Rathore called for renewed negotiations to ease tensions, as JAAC demands the abolition of 12 Legislative Assembly seats reserved for refugees from Indian-occupied Jammu and Kashmir.
